Doctor
Sintaxis del Lenguaje Java
Temario
SINTAXIS BÁSICA SECUENCIAS DE ESCAPE TIPOS DE DATOS PRIMITIVOS VARIABLES OPERADORES INSTRUCCIONES DE CONTROL ARRAYS TIPOS ENUMERADOS
F. Mayorga
Sintaxis básica
Lenguaje sensible a Mayúsculas/Minúsculas Las sentencias finalizan con “;” Los bloques deinstrucciones se delimitan con llaves {…} Comentarios de una línea y multilínea.
//una
línea /*varias líneas */
F. Mayorga
Secuencias de Escape
Una secuencia de escape está formada por el carácter “\” seguido de una letra, en el caso de ciertos caracteres no imprimibles, o del carácter especial. La siguiente tabla muestra las principales secuencias de escape predefinidas en java.Secuencia de Escape \b \n \t \\ \’ \”
Significado Retroceso Salto de línea Tabulación horizontal Barra invertida \ Comilla simple Comilla doble
F. Mayorga
Secuencias de Escape
Por ejemplo si quisiéramos mostrar:
Java IDE
“virtual” “netbeans”
Utilizaríamos la instrucción: System.out.println(“Java\t\”virtual\”\nIDE\t\”netbeans\””);
F. Mayorga
Tipos de DatosPrimitivos
Toda la información que se maneja en un programa Java puede estar representada bien por un objeto o bien por un dato básico o de tipo primitivo. Java soporta los 8 tipos de datos primitivos que se muestran a continuación: Tipo básico byte short int long char float double boolean Tamaño 8 bits 16 bits 32 bits 64 bits 16 bits 32 bits 64 bits -
F. Mayorga
Tipos de DatosPrimitivos
Los tipos de datos primitivos se pueden organizar en 4 grupos: Numéricos enteros.- byte, short, int, long. Carácter.- char Numérico decimal.- float y double Lógicos.- boolean en el cual los valores posibles a representar son true y false.
F. Mayorga
Variables
Una variable es un espacio físico de memoria donde un programa puede almacenar un dato para su posteriorutilización. Se pueden manejar 2 tipos de datos en una variable: Tipo primitivo (mencionados anteriormente), Tipo objeto. Tipo primitivo: int k = 40; Tipo objeto: los objetos en java también se almacenan en variables, solo que a diferencia de los primitivos estas variables no contienen el dato real del objeto sino una referencia al mismo.
automazda am = new automazda();
F.Mayorga
Declaración de variables
Como se muestra en ejemplos anteriores una variable se la declara de la siguiente manera: tipo_dato nombre_variable;
Un nombre de variable válido debe cumplir con las siguientes reglas:
Debe comenzar con un caracter alfabético No puede contener espacios, signos de puntuación o secuencias de escape No puede utilizarse como nombre de variableuna palabra reservada java.
También es posible declarar en una misma instrucción varias variables de igual tipo: tipo_dato variable1, variable2, variable3;
F. Mayorga
Ejemplos de declaración de variables
Válidas int h,per; long p1; char cad_1;
No válidas boolean 7m; //comienza con un número int num uno; //contiene espacio en blanco long new; //utiliza una palabra reservadaF. Mayorga
Asignación de variables
Una vez declarada una variable se la puede asignar un valor siguiendo el siguiente formato: variable = expresión; Donde expresión puede ser cualquier expresión java válida que devuelva un valor acorde con el tipo de dato declarado. int j, k, l; j=25; k=j*3; l=j*k;
También es posible asignar un valor inicial a la variable en el momento dela declaración: int num-5; int g, p=2;
F. Mayorga
Ámbito de las variables
Según donde esté declarada la variable esta puede ser: Campo o atributo.- declaradas al principio de la clase, fuera de los métodos. Variable local.- variables declaradas dentro de un método, su ámbito de utilización está restringido al interior del método. Las variable locales deben ser inicializadas antes...
Regístrate para leer el documento completo.